Four people were yesterday arrested at Fomena following disturbances at the NDC constituency elections in the Adansi North constituency in the Ashanti region.
The Police in a post on Facebook said details of the arrest would be shared in due course.
Meanwhile, angry delegates of the opposition National Democratic Congress (NDC) in the New Juaben South constituency in the Eastern region stormed out of the venue for the Constituency election over delayed arrival of ballot papers.
The election which was scheduled to begin at 9:00am had not commenced as at 1:45pm on Saturday October 22,2022 as at the time of filing this report.
New Juaben South has the highest number of delegates in Eastern region with 1,569 from 179 branches.
The delegates converged at the Eredecs Hotel since morning waiting for the election to commence.
At 1:45pm ,some of the delegates grabbed microphone to vent their displeasure over the delay and lack of communication.
They threatened to beat members of the election committee at the regional level .
Subsequently,they incited the delegates to collectively walkout.
Some of the candidates contesting the polls say the delay and postponement of the election will gravely affect them.
